1. History of Human Cannonball

The human cannonball act has a long and fascinating history dating back to the late 19th century. The first recorded human cannonball performance took place in England in 1877 when a performer named “Zazel” was launched from a cannon at the Royal Aquarium in London. Since then, the act has become a popular feature in circuses, theme parks, and daredevil shows around the world.

3. The Launch Sequence

The launch sequence of a human cannonball act is a carefully choreographed process that involves precise timing and coordination. The performer enters the cannon and assumes a specific position to ensure a smooth trajectory through the air. The cannon is then loaded with the necessary amount of compressed air or gunpowder before being fired, propelling the performer into the sky.

5. Popular Human Cannonball Performers

Over the years, there have been many legendary human cannonball performers who have wowed audiences with their death-defying stunts. Some of the most famous human cannonballs include Zacchini family, David “The Bullet” Smith, Gemma “The Jet” Kirby, and Brian Miser.
